High reactivity under long-wavelength UV-A and visible light (350–420 nm), enabling efficient curing with LED sources.
Low yellowing tendency, delivering excellent clarity and color stability in final cured films.
Good solubility in common acrylate monomers and oligomers, facilitating homogeneous formulation blending.
Reduced odor and volatility compared to traditional Type II photoinitiators, improving workplace safety and handling.
Excellent surface cure performance, even under inert or low-oxygen conditions, minimizing oxygen inhibition effects.
